The Bank of Ireland for Intermediaries has appointed Dave Rogers and Louise Weiss as national account managers.

Rogers joins from Barclays where he worked for 13 years, most recently as intermediary business director. Prior to that, he was intermediary partnership director. He stepped down from his role last month. 

Rogers brings more than 20 years of experience to the Bank of Ireland for Intermediaries. 

Weiss has worked for the lender since the start of this year, having joined as a business development manager. 

She previously worked as a mortgage adviser and has been employed by Xpress Mortgages as well as Charles Cameron and Associates. 

Alan Longhorn, head of sales, marketing and distribution at Bank of Ireland for Intermediaries, said: “I’m delighted to have Dave and Louise join us as we continue to invest in our national account management team. Both Dave and Louise bring complementary skills and experience to the team and will play an important role in further developing, enhancing and growing our intermediary relationships.
